Ticket: Drift in Relaymast webhook retry settings

For the release manager: staging and prod have diverged on webhook retry behavior. Prod still uses the old fixed three-attempt schedule; staging moved to backoff-with-cap last sprint. Partner integrations tested against staging will see different failure timing in prod. Recommend freezing the next release until settings are reconciled. The values currently deployed to prod are listed below.

deployment values, yadug-bawif:
[framir]
team = pelox
access_code = ac_a38ab2
owner = tamion.julael
host = framir.tolvaqlabs.test
port = 11211
peer = tammir.zemvargrid.local
salt = 2215ef03
pin = 1541

## Deployment

The Marrowfield ORM refactor replaces the legacy Slatebound mapper with the new repository layer. Deploy in two phases: enable dual-write mode first, verify parity for 24 hours, then cut reads over. Rollback only requires toggling the read flag back. Both phases read from the same config, and the current production values follow.

service settings:
[casax]
port = 6379
team = rusir
host = casax.zemvarhq.corp
region = outer-4
access_code = ac_9808ce
timeout_ms = 1500

**Ticket: Breaker env misconfigured in plugin sandbox**

Plugin authors targeting the Fenwick upstream gateway are seeing constant open-circuit errors in the sandbox. Root cause: `FENWICK_BREAKER_THRESHOLD` was set to 1 instead of 25, tripping the breaker on any single failure. Fix the threshold in your plugin's env file, then re-add the gateway credential the sandbox reset wiped, placing it on the very next line.

sealed setting: RELAY_SECRET5=82864